Anyone going to the Euros by bike?

Going with a couple of mates to follow Wales in Euro 2016 final tournament. If you are Welsh, seeing your team in a major tournament is literally a once in a lifetime thing.

We going from Cardiff to Portsmouth, to get the ferry to St-Malo. Then we just head south to Bordeaux to see Wales play Slovakia. We are the going on to Toulouse for the Russian game.

Then we get the TGV to Paris, I could only book two bike places, I hope we can get another one when we turn up. Turning a bike into a luggage is an inconvenience. Then the Eurostar home. The guys looked worried when I said we'd probably need to disassemble the bikes.

Wales v England in Lens is too far away to ride, so we're staying in Bordeaux - which is much nicer anyway.
